在当今数字化的时代,网络安全面临着各种威胁,其中 DDoS(分布式拒绝服务)攻击是一种常见且极具破坏性的攻击方式。它通过利用大量的计算机或设备发起大规模的网络流量攻击,使目标系统或网络无法正常提供服务,给企业和个人带来巨大的损失。因此,规划有效的防 DDoS 攻击措施至关重要。
一、了解 DDoS 攻击的类型和特点
要深入了解 DDoS 攻击的类型,如 SYN 洪水攻击、UDP 洪水攻击、ICMP 洪水攻击等。每种攻击类型的原理和特点不同,了解它们有助于针对性地制定防御策略。SYN 洪水攻击通过大量伪造的 TCP 连接请求耗尽目标服务器的资源;UDP 洪水攻击则利用 UDP 协议的无连接特性发送大量无用数据包;ICMP 洪水攻击则通过发送大量的 ICMP 回显请求数据包来消耗网络带宽和目标系统的处理能力。
二、建立完善的网络架构和安全策略
1. 网络架构设计:采用分层的网络架构,将不同的业务系统和网络区域进行隔离,限制攻击流量的扩散。例如,将内部网络与外部网络通过防火墙进行隔离,设置不同的访问控制策略。
2. 流量清洗:部署流量清洗设备,如 DDoS 清洗中心或硬件防火墙。这些设备可以对进入网络的流量进行检测和清洗,去除恶意的攻击流量,确保合法的业务流量能够正常通过。
3. 访问控制:实施严格的访问控制策略,限制对关键业务系统的访问权限。只允许授权的用户和设备访问网络,防止攻击者通过合法的途径发起攻击。
4. 安全监控:建立实时的网络安全监控系统,对网络流量、系统日志等进行监控和分析。及时发现异常的网络活动和攻击行为,并采取相应的措施进行处理。
三、加强主机和应用安全
1. 操作系统安全:及时更新操作系统的补丁,关闭不必要的服务和端口,减少系统的安全漏洞。同时,加强用户账户管理,设置强密码,限制用户的权限。
2. 应用程序安全:对应用程序进行安全评估和测试,修复潜在的安全漏洞。采用安全的编程规范,防止代码注入、跨站脚本等攻击。
3. 备份和恢复:定期对重要的数据和系统进行备份,以便在遭受攻击后能够快速恢复业务。备份数据应存储在安全的位置,并定期进行测试和验证。
四、与安全服务提供商合作
1. DDoS 防护服务:可以与专业的安全服务提供商合作,购买 DDoS 防护服务。这些服务提供商拥有先进的检测和防御技术,能够及时应对大规模的 DDoS 攻击。
2. 安全咨询和培训:寻求安全服务提供商的安全咨询和培训服务,了解最新的网络安全威胁和防御技术,提高企业内部的安全意识和应对能力。
五、制定应急预案和演练
1. 应急预案:制定详细的应急预案,明确在遭受 DDoS 攻击时的应对措施和流程。包括如何及时发现攻击、如何与安全服务提供商联系、如何进行流量清洗和系统恢复等。
2. 演练:定期进行 DDoS 攻击演练,检验应急预案的有效性和可行性。通过演练,提高企业内部的应急响应能力和团队协作能力。
规划防 DDoS 攻击需要综合考虑网络架构、安全策略、主机和应用安全、与安全服务提供商合作以及应急预案等多个方面。只有建立起完善的防御体系,才能有效地抵御 DDoS 攻击,保障网络的安全和稳定。企业和个人应高度重视网络安全,不断加强安全防护措施,以应对日益复杂的网络安全威胁。